How pool water treatment actually works
At its core, pool water treatment involves using specialized equipment and chemicals to maintain clear, clean water. This process typically involves three key steps: sanitizing, balancing, and stabilizing. Sanitizers like chlorine or bromine kill bacteria and other microorganisms, while balancers adjust the pH and alkalinity levels to ensure a safe and comfortable swimming environment. Stabilizers, on the other hand, help to prevent the loss of chlorine due to sunlight exposure. By combining these steps, pool water treatment systems can provide a safe and enjoyable swimming experience.
